Inspection Procedure
- CHECK THAT MIL IS ILLUMINATED
- Turn the ignition switch on (IG).
- Check the illumination of the MIL.
Result
RESULT CHARTResult Proceed to MIL remains illuminated (Even after power switch on (IG) and several seconds have passed, MIL still remains illuminated) A MIL remains off (Does not illuminate at all) B B: Go to step 5
A: Go to Next Step
- CHECK WHETHER MIL TURNS OFF
- Connect the Techstream to the DLC3.
- Turn the power switch on (IG) and turn the Techstream on.
- Select the following menu items: Powertrain / Engine and ECT / Trouble Code.
- Check if any DTCs have been stored. Note down any DTCs.
- Clear the DTCs (See DTC CHECK / CLEAR ).
- Check if the MIL goes off.
Standard: MIL goes off.
NG: Go to step 3
OK: REPAIR CIRCUITS INDICATED BY OUTPUT DTCS
- CHECK HARNESS AND CONNECTOR (CHECK FOR SHORT IN WIRE HARNESS)
- Disconnect the hybrid vehicle control ECU connector.
- Turn the power switch on (IG).
- Check that the MIL is not illuminated.
OK: MIL is not illuminated.
- Reconnect the hybrid vehicle control ECU connector.
NG: Go to step 4
OK: REPLACE HYBRID VEHICLE CONTROL ECU (See REMOVAL )
- CHECK HARNESS AND CONNECTOR (COMBINATION METER - HYBRID VEHICLE CONTROL ECU)
- Disconnect the hybrid vehicle control ECU connector.
- Disconnect the combination meter connector.
- Measure the resistance according to the value (s) in the table below.
Standard resistance (Check for Open)
TESTER CONNECTION SPECIFIED CONDITIONTester Connection Condition Specified Condition D35-14 (W) - E1-10 (CHK) Always Below 1 Ω Standard resistance (Check for Short)
TESTER CONNECTION SPECIFIED CONDITIONTester Connection Condition Specified Condition D35-14 (W) or E1-10 (CHK) - Body ground Always 10 kΩ or higher - Reconnect the hybrid vehicle control ECU connector.
- Reconnect the combination meter connector.
NG: REPAIR OR REPLACE HARNESS OR CONNECTOR (COMBINATION METER HYBRID VEHICLE CONTROL ECU)
OK: REPLACE COMBINATION METER ASSEMBLY (See COMBINATION METER )
- CHECK THAT ENGINE STARTS
- Turn the power switch on (IG).
- Switch the hybrid vehicle control ECU from normal mode to check mode (See CHECK MODE PROCEDURE ).
- Start the engine.
Result
RESULT CHARTResult Proceed to Engine starts A Engine does not start* B HINT:
*: The Techstream cannot communicate with the hybrid vehicle control ECU.
B: GO TO VC OUTPUT CIRCUIT (See VC OUTPUT CIRCUIT )
A: Go to Next Step
- CHECK HARNESS AND CONNECTOR (COMBINATION METER - BODY GROUND)
- Disconnect the hybrid vehicle control ECU connector.
- Turn the power switch on (IG).
- Measure the voltage according to the value (s) in the table below.
Standard voltage
TESTER CONNECTION SPECIFIED CONDITIONTester Connection Condition Specified Condition D35-14 (W) - Body ground Power switch on (IG) 11 to 14 V - Reconnect the hybrid vehicle control ECU connector.
NG: Go to step 7
OK: REPLACE HYBRID VEHICLE CONTROL ECU (See REMOVAL )
- CHECK HARNESS AND CONNECTOR (COMBINATION METER - HYBRID VEHICLE CONTROL ECU)
- Disconnect the hybrid vehicle control ECU connector.
- Disconnect the combination meter connector.
- Measure the resistance according to the value (s) in the table below.
Standard resistance (Check for short)
TESTER CONNECTION SPECIFIED CONDITIONTester Connection Condition Specified Condition D35-14 (W) - E1-10 Always Below 1 Ω Standard resistance (Check for Short)
TESTER CONNECTION SPECIFIED CONDITIONTester Connection Condition Specified Condition D36-30 (W) or E1-10 - Body ground Always 10 kΩ or higher - Reconnect the hybrid vehicle control ECU connector.
- Reconnect the combination meter connector.
NG: REPAIR OR REPLACE HARNESS OR CONNECTOR (COMBINATION METER HYBRID VEHICLE CONTROL ECU)
OK: REPLACE COMBINATION METER ASSEMBLY (See COMBINATION METER )
